> my toshiba tecra 8000 doesn't make a single beep when using the alsa opl3sa2
> driver. the resources are forced by hand (since pnpc_ doesn't work here),
> i also tried a quick pnp (no cards) hack, the chip is detected correctly,
> but still doesn't make sound. the card shows up in /proc/asound/.
> when 'playing' sound, /proc/asound/card0/pcm0p/sub0/status shows nice values.
> i used alsamixer to give full volume to all channels, still no results...
please try to touch the PCM volume after playing the sound again.
it seems that there is a bug hidden in alsa opl3sa2 driver, occuring
on some notebooks. unfortunately, i cannot debug this due to lack of
hardware...
